List of Steel Magnolia’s Problems When I Purchased Her
Here’s the list of everything wrong with the boat at the time I purchased it with the repaired items crossed through. I only keep this here to remind me that I am making progress.
1. No hot water in forward shower.
2. Lower deck toilets do not flush properly and cannot be used except with sea water without flooding.
3. Hot and cold water reversed to kitchen sink.
4. Engine badly out of alignment with prop shaft.
5. Engine shaft coupling improperly sized which, combined with alignment caused breakdown in Lake Michigan.
6. Anchor windlass switch in pilothouse wired backwards causing safety pin to break when attempting to anchor.
7. Engine alternator not wired to charge engine start battery.
8. Shore power setup hopelessly inadequate to power boat without running generator.
9. Inverter/battery charger control panel not working requiring new panel and new wiring. Charger was set to Gel Cell batteries rather than wet batteries.
10. Master shower sump clogged and located where it cannot be cleaned out…overflows into bilge.
11. Starboard windshield wiper not working…was never wired up to power.
12. Microwave oven will not function when using inverter for power.
13. One of kitchen light fixtures has no wiring attached to it.
14. Master shower control valve installed backwards.
15. Five gallons of distilled water required to top off seven batteries in engine room.
16. Horn doesn’t work.
17. Chain locker filled with water instead of recommended amount of lead ballast.
